The Patriots Technology Training Center
Bio-Medical Competition & Dinner
Date: May 8, 2025 – 6 PM to 9 PM
Location: Bowie State University
No. of Attendees: 40 middle students
Prizes:1ˢᵗ – $100; 2ⁿᵈ – $50; 3ʳᵈ – $25
About: Patriots has established a partnership with local hospitals to guide a group of 3 middle/high school students in creating a research paper, flyer, poster board display, and website focusing on different medical specialties and treatments. The teams will present their project at a dinner event before a panel of medical professionals attended by their teachers, family, and friends. Specialties: Anesthesiologist, Cardiology, Dermatologist, Neurologist, Obstetrics Gynecologist, Pediatrician, Psychiatrist, Radiologist.

Rocket Science
June 23-27 - Grades K-3
(half-day)
maSTErMinds campers will use the scientific method and their knowledge of Newton’s Laws to understand how rockets launch. Campers will participate in various activities and rocket launches to help them better understand the science and engineering principles behind rockets such as altitude, velocity, and forces.
